DRDO to host Intl Conference on Electronic Warfare
DRDO to host Intl Conference on Electronic Warfare

Bangalore: India’s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) would host, first International Conference on Electronic Warfare, EWCI 2010 for two days from tomorrow, Dr U K Revankar, Director, Defence Avionics Research Establishment (DARE) informed here today.

Speaking to newsmen Dr Revankar said that about 100 technical papers, half of them from overseas countries would be presented on the occasion in which over 400 delegates would participate/ He said that about 11 countries, including Israel, U.K, Italy, France are participating besides featuring 60 exhibition stalls from various parts of the globe displaying state-of-the-art Electronic Warfare products.

He said the the Conference was expected to throws up amble of opportunities to develop business partnership for the development of EW Systems, with advanced Countries which will further enhance the expertise in the Country.

He said that the Conference is being held to increase country's strength in EW, to expand vistas to provide effective solutions, share the experience with the developed nations and to establish the partnership for success in EW.

"The Conference agenda has been carefully selected to address current and future needs of the operational users, planners, developers, procurers, testers and trainers of the latest EW Technologies and Systems".

Stating that "EW: Partnering for success' was the theme of the Conference, he expressed confidence that the event would help in providing technical exposure to Indian Scientific and Industrial community for generating the Business and Partnership opportunities among the International E W community.
